A stockbroker is an individual or company that buys and sells stocks and other investments for a financial market participant in return for a commission, markup, or fee.In most countries they are regulated as a broker or broker-dealer and may need to hold a relevant license and may be a member of a stock exchange.
Mirae Asset Sharekhan is an Indian retail brokerage and full-service brokerage firm. As of 2024, it was the twelfth-largest full-service brokerage and the eighth-largest stock broker in India. [4] [5] The company introduced online trading in India in its early years. [6]
